# Artifact Signing — Whistlecote Audio Guide

All builds of the Whistlecote museum audio-guide app are signed in CI before distribution to venue kiosks. Kiosks verify the signature at install and refuse unsigned bundles. The signer runs in an isolated job with no network egress; rotation happens quarterly. For the current review cycle, artifacts should be checked against the signing key below.

rollout seal: bky4_DFM9

## Capacity Note: ProseCheck Linter

ProseCheck runs on every docs merge request at Fernhollow. Current load is roughly 400 runs/day, each scanning up to 2,000 files. Memory scales with the largest file, not repo size, so we cap file length and parallel workers rather than total throughput. Worker pool growth beyond eight showed no speedup in benchmarks. The limits below reflect those measurements.

tuning table, yajog-yahof:
BUDGETS = {
    "lamvan": 303,
    "wenox": 460,
    "fenvan": 525,
}

Subject: Handover — planner regression on Corvid DB

Handing off the query planner regression in Corvid 9.4. Joins on the `shipments` fact table pick a nested loop instead of hash join after last night's stats refresh; p95 latency tripled. Workaround: pinned the old plan via hint in the top three queries. Vendor ticket is open; updates go to the address below.

escalation mailbox, bafog-fafog: ulador@paliqlabs.internal

## Authentication

Heads up: the nightly reindex job (`reindex_nightly.py`) talks to the Lanternfish search cluster, and that cluster won't accept anonymous writes anymore — we locked it down last sprint. The job now authenticates as the `reindex-runner` service identity against Corvid Gateway, and the token is injected via the `LF_INDEX_TOKEN` env var in the scheduler config. Nothing clever going on, just a bearer header on every batch request. For review purposes, the staging credential currently in use is listed below.

service key, kadug-kadup: kto15_rN23XLAYImmZgrJ